Output 63f355f9fe0b7ef9f6f92b123808b5922a8f51ad1071936971673e25c96aa73a:1

value
871456
script pubkey
OP_HASH160 OP_PUSHBYTES_20 cf69666b1b90e714660b98247318b84e4e21846e OP_EQUAL
address
3Lbi4aUjtiWJNguPmZG9cYdVc19vCTPD5x
transaction
63f355f9fe0b7ef9f6f92b123808b5922a8f51ad1071936971673e25c96aa73a
spent
true